Smartlead MCP Server
This is a Model Context Protocol (MCP) server for Smartlead campaign management integration. It provides tools for creating and managing campaigns, updating campaign settings, and managing campaign sequences.
Features
- Create new campaigns
- Update campaign schedule settings
- Update campaign general settings
- Get campaign details
- List all campaigns with filtering options
- Manage campaign email sequences (save, get, update, delete)
- Manage email accounts in campaigns (add, update, delete)
- Manage leads in campaigns (add, update, delete)
Installation
1. Clone the repository
2. Install dependencies:
npm install
3. Create a .env file based on .env.example and add your Smartlead API key:
SMARTLEAD_API_KEY=your_api_key_here
4. Build the project:
npm run build
Usage
Standalone Usage
To start the server directly:
npm start
Integration with Claude
To use this MCP server with Claude, you need to add it to the MCP settings file:
1. For Claude VSCode extension, add it to c:\Users\<username>\AppData\Roaming\Code\User\globalStorage\saoudrizwan.claude-dev\settings\cline_mcp_settings.json
2. For Claude desktop app, add it to %APPDATA%\Claude\claude_desktop_config.json on Windows
Example configuration:
{
"mcpServers": {
"smartlead": {
"command": "node",
"args": ["E:/mcp-servers/smartlead/dist/index.js"],
"env": {
"SMARTLEAD_API_KEY": "your_api_key_here"
},
"disabled": false,
"autoApprove": []
}
}
}
Replace your_api_key_here with your actual Smartlead API key.
Configuration
The server can be configured using environment variables:
- SMARTLEAD_API_KEY (required): Your Smartlead API key
- SMARTLEAD_API_URL (optional): Custom API URL (defaults to https://server.smartlead.ai/api/v1)
- SMARTLEAD_RETRY_MAX_ATTEMPTS: Maximum retry attempts for API calls (default: 3)
- SMARTLEAD_RETRY_INITIAL_DELAY: Initial delay in milliseconds for retries (default: 1000)
- SMARTLEAD_RETRY_MAX_DELAY: Maximum delay in milliseconds for retries (default: 10000)
- SMARTLEAD_RETRY_BACKOFF_FACTOR: Backoff factor for retry delays (default: 2)
Available Tools
smartlead_create_campaign
Create a new campaign in Smartlead.
Parameters:
- name (required): Name of the campaign
- client_id (optional): Client ID for the campaign
smartlead_update_campaign_schedule
Update a campaign's schedule settings.
Parameters:
- campaign_id (required): ID of the campaign to update
- timezone: Timezone for the campaign (e.g., "America/Los_Angeles")
- days_of_the_week: Days of the week to send emails (1-7, where 1 is Monday)
- start_hour: Start hour in 24-hour format (e.g., "09:00")
- end_hour: End hour in 24-hour format (e.g., "17:00")
- min_time_btw_emails: Minimum time between emails in minutes
- max_new_leads_per_day: Maximum number of new leads per day
- schedule_start_time: Schedule start time in ISO format
smartlead_update_campaign_settings
Update a campaign's general settings.
Parameters:
- campaign_id (required): ID of the campaign to update
- name: New name for the campaign
- status: Status of the campaign (active, paused, completed)
- settings: Additional campaign settings
smartlead_get_campaign
Get details of a specific campaign by ID.
Parameters:
- campaign_id (required): ID of the campaign to retrieve
smartlead_list_campaigns
List all campaigns with optional filtering.
Parameters:
- status: Filter campaigns by status (active, paused, completed, all)
- limit: Maximum number of campaigns to return
- offset: Offset for pagination
smartlead_save_campaign_sequence
Save a sequence of emails for a campaign with A/B testing variants.
Parameters:
- campaign_id (required): ID of the campaign
- sequences (required): Array of email sequence items, each with:
- id: ID of the sequence (only for updates, omit when creating)
- seq_number (required): Sequence number (order in the sequence)
- seq_delay_details (required): Delay settings with:
- delay_in_days (required): Days to wait before sending this email
- variant_distribution_type: Type of variant distribution (MANUAL_EQUAL, MANUAL_PERCENTAGE, AI_EQUAL)
- lead_distribution_percentage: Sample percentage size of the lead pool to use to find the winner
- winning_metric_property: Metric to use for determining the winning variant (OPEN_RATE, CLICK_RATE, REPLY_RATE, POSITIVE_REPLY_RATE)
- seq_variants: Array of email variants, each with:
- subject (required): Email subject line
- email_body (required): Email body content (HTML)
- variant_label (required): Label for the variant (e.g., "A", "B", "C")
- id: ID of the variant (only for updates, omit when creating)
- variant_distribution_percentage: Percentage of leads to receive this variant
- subject: Email subject line (for simple follow-ups, blank makes it in the same thread)
- email_body: Email body content (HTML) for simple follow-ups
smartlead_get_campaign_sequence
Get the sequence of emails for a campaign.
Parameters:
- campaign_id (required): ID of the campaign
smartlead_update_campaign_sequence
Update a specific email in a campaign sequence.
Parameters:
- campaign_id (required): ID of the campaign
- sequence_id (required): ID of the sequence email to update
- subject: Updated email subject line
- body: Updated email body content
- wait_days: Updated days to wait before sending this email
smartlead_delete_campaign_sequence
Delete a specific email from a campaign sequence.
Parameters:
- campaign_id (required): ID of the campaign
- sequence_id (required): ID of the sequence email to delete
smartlead_add_email_account_to_campaign
Add an email account to a campaign.
Parameters:
- campaign_id (required): ID of the campaign
- email_account_id (required): ID of the email account to add
smartlead_update_email_account_in_campaign
Update an email account in a campaign.
Parameters:
- campaign_id (required): ID of the campaign
- email_account_id (required): ID of the email account to update
- settings: Settings for the email account in this campaign
smartlead_delete_email_account_from_campaign
Remove an email account from a campaign.
Parameters:
- campaign_id (required): ID of the campaign
- email_account_id (required): ID of the email account to remove
smartlead_add_lead_to_campaign
Add leads to a campaign (up to 100 leads at once).
Parameters:
- campaign_id (required): ID of the campaign
- lead_list (required): Array of lead information objects (max 100), each with:
- email (required): Email address of the lead
- first_name: First name of the lead
- last_name: Last name of the lead
- company_name: Company name of the lead
- phone_number: Phone number of the lead
- website: Website of the lead
- location: Location of the lead
- custom_fields: Custom fields for the lead (max 20 fields)
- linkedin_profile: LinkedIn profile URL of the lead
- company_url: Company URL of the lead
- settings: Settings for lead addition:
- ignore_global_block_list: If true, uploaded leads will bypass the global block list
- ignore_unsubscribe_list: If true, leads will bypass the comparison with unsubscribed leads
- ignore_community_bounce_list: If true, uploaded leads will bypass any leads that bounced across the entire userbase
- ignore_duplicate_leads_in_other_campaign: If true, leads will NOT bypass the comparison with other campaigns
smartlead_update_lead_in_campaign
Update a lead in a campaign.
Parameters:
- campaign_id (required): ID of the campaign
- lead_id (required): ID of the lead to update
- lead (required): Updated lead information with:
- email: Email address of the lead
- first_name: First name of the lead
- last_name: Last name of the lead
- company: Company of the lead
- custom_variables: Custom variables for the lead
smartlead_delete_lead_from_campaign
Remove a lead from a campaign.
Parameters:
- campaign_id (required): ID of the campaign
- lead_id (required): ID of the lead to remove
